A direct fluorescent antibody test for large spirochetes in swine dysentery using hyperimmunized swine serum.

C H Lee, L D Olson.   

Abstract

A direct fluorescent antibody test was developed for the identification of large spirochetes which are considered to be the cause of swine dysentery. Sera from swine which had recovered from swine dysentery and had been hyperimmunized by the intravenous and intraperitoneal injection of filtered spirochetes were used for conjugation with fluorescein isothiocyanate. A bright greenish fluorescence of large spirochetes was observed with the conjugated serum from hyperimmunized pig No. 1 when diluted 1:8 and hyperimmunized pig No. 2 when diluted 1:2. Pig No. 1 had developed a serum titer of 1:64 using the indirect fluorescent antibody test for large spirochetes. The conjugated serum from the three swine which had recovered from swine dysentery fluoresced spirochetes only when undiluted. The conjugated serum from the two swine treated while having a hemorrhagic diarrhea did not fluoresce spirochetes. No immunofluorescence of Vibrio spp. was observed.
